- #ifndef _ASM_X86_NUMA_64_H
- #define _ASM_X86_NUMA_64_H
- #include <linux/nodemask.h>
- #include <asm/apicdef.h>
- struct bootnode {
- u64 start;
- u64 end;
- };
- extern int compute_hash_shift(struct bootnode *nodes, int numblks,
- int *nodeids);
- #define ZONE_ALIGN (1UL << (MAX_ORDER+PAGE_SHIFT))
- extern void numa_init_array(void);
- extern int numa_off;
- extern void srat_reserve_add_area(int nodeid);
- extern int hotadd_percent;
- extern s16 apicid_to_node[MAX_LOCAL_APIC];
- extern unsigned long numa_free_all_bootmem(void);
- extern void setup_node_bootmem(int nodeid, unsigned long start,
- unsigned long end);
- #ifdef CONFIG_NUMA
- extern void __init init_cpu_to_node(void);
- extern void __cpuinit numa_set_node(int cpu, int node);
- extern void __cpuinit numa_clear_node(int cpu);
- extern void __cpuinit numa_add_cpu(int cpu);
- extern void __cpuinit numa_remove_cpu(int cpu);
- #else
- static inline void init_cpu_to_node(void) { }
- static inline void numa_set_node(int cpu, int node) { }
- static inline void numa_clear_node(int cpu) { }
- static inline void numa_add_cpu(int cpu, int node) { }
- static inline void numa_remove_cpu(int cpu) { }
- #endif
- #endif /* _ASM_X86_NUMA_64_H */
